#910612 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#910612 is composed of 56.9% red, 2.4%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.9% magenta, 87.6%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 354.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 29.6%. #910612 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0c24 with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#910612 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#910612 has RGB values of R:145, G:6,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.88,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9504274.

Shades and Tints of #910612
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0102 is the darkest color, while #fff9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#910612
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514647 is the less saturated color, while #97000d is the most saturated one.
